Families moving to Catron gain access to the Risco R-II School District, known for its attentive approach and small class sizes that ensure each student receives personalized support. With extracurricular programs and community involvement, students and parents alike take pride in educational opportunities available within a short drive.
Outdoor enthusiasts enjoy quick access to the beauty of the Ten Mile Pond Conservation Area, a haven for birdwatchers, hunters, and those who savor the tranquil waters ideal for fishing or simply enjoying the changing seasons. A short journey brings residents to New Madrid, with its historic sites like the New Madrid Historical Museum, and Sikeston, where a variety of dining and shopping options await.
